Snowfall reports from around the Northland for the storm that affected the region late Friday night into Saturday, as relayed by the National Weather Service in Duluth:
9 inches - Leader 8.5 inches - Dixon Lake 8.3 inches - Bigfork 8 inches - Duluth (Kenwood area) 7 inches - Esko (10 miles N), Askov (10 miles N), Cook (8 miles ENE), Squaw Lake, Pillager 6.6 inches - Kabetogama, Boulder Lake 6.5 inches - Alborn, Brainerd, Isabella (14 miles W) 6.3 inches - Two Harbors (6 miles W) 6.1 inches - Duluth Heights 6 inches - Duluth airport, Cloquet, Culver 5.9 inches - Wright 5.8 inches - Coleraine 5.7 inches - Orr 5.6 inches - Nashwauk 5.4 inches - Northome 5.3 inches - Silver Bay, Lutsen 5.2 inches - Duluth (Hunters Park) 5.1 inches - Brimson 5 inches - Sawyer, Celina, Larsmont, Grand Rapids (7 miles SE), Two Harbors, Lake Nichols, McGregor, Sand Point Lake 4.8 inches - Beaver Bay, Nisswa 4.3 inches - Little Marais 4.1 inches - Tower 4 inches - Lakewood Township, Ely, Embarrass, Tofte, Hovland, Fort Ripley, Emily 3.7 inches - Grand Marais, Malmo 3.6 inches - Chisholm 3.5 inches - International Falls 3 inches - Superior 2.5 inches - Moose Lake 2.3 inches - Holyoke 1.5 inches - Upson 1.2 inches - Superior (7 miles SE) 1.1 inches - Bayfield (8 miles N) 1 inch - Solon Springs, Phillips, Sarona 0.5 inches - La Pointe
